A direct lender is a company that provides and funds the loan directly to you, without using a third-party broker. This means you communicate and transact with the same entity from application to repayment. For Belfield residents, working with a direct lender can sometimes mean a faster process and clearer communication, as you're dealing with the source of the funds. It's crucial to verify that any lender you consider is licensed to operate in North Dakota. The state has specific regulations, including a maximum loan amount and fee structure, which all legitimate direct lenders must follow. You can check a lender's license through the North Dakota Department of Financial Institutions website.

Payday loans are designed for very short-term emergencies, not ongoing financial gaps. If you decide to proceed, always read the loan agreement thoroughly. North Dakota law caps the maximum loan amount at $500, and lenders can charge a maximum fee of 20% of the first $300 loaned and 7.5% on amounts between $300.01 and $500. Calculate the total cost of repayment, including these fees, before you sign. A responsible direct lender will make these terms crystal clear.
Managing repayment is key. Align your due date with your pay schedule, perhaps from work at a local energy or agricultural business. The most significant risk with payday loans is the cycle of debt, where borrowers take out a new loan to repay the old one. Create a tight budget for the loan period to ensure you can cover the repayment without needing another loan.
